Clark Man Sentenced for Receipt and Distribution of Child Pornography

A Clark, South Dakota man has been sentenced to 120 months in federal prison for his role in a child pornography case.

On November 29, 2021, U.S. District Judge Charles B. Kornmann handed down the sentence to Anthony Dialo Holmes, 37, for the Receipt and Distribution of Child Pornography.

According to court documents, Holmes knowingly received and distributed child pornography between September 1, 2019, and May 22, 2020. He used his Kik Messenger social media account to send and receive files depicting minors engaged in sexually explicit conduct.

Holmes was indicted by a federal grand jury on August 17, 2020. He pled guilty to the charges on August 31, 2021.

The case was investigated by the South Dakota Division of Criminal Investigation and Homeland Security Investigations. Assistant U.S. Attorney Jeffrey C. Clapper prosecuted the case.

In addition to his prison sentence, Holmes was ordered to serve 10 years of supervised release and pay a special assessment to the Federal Crime Victims Fund in the amount of $100.

Holmes was immediately turned over to the custody of the U.S. Marshals Service.
